Gavin Sheets and the San Diego Padres take the field on Thursday at Oracle Park against Robbie Ray, who is starting for the San Francisco Giants. First pitch will be at 3:45 p.m. ET for the final game of a four-game series. The favored Padres have -115 moneyline odds against the underdog Giants, who are listed at -104. San Diego is favored on the run line (-1.5). The total is 7 runs for this game (with -117 odds on the over and -103 odds to go under).

Here's everything you need to know from a betting perspective on the Padres-Giants game, regarding the run line, moneyline and total, plus expert picks.

Padres vs. Giants Betting Insights

  • The Padres have entered the game as favorites 35 times this season and won 21, or 60%, of those games.
  • This season San Diego has won 20 of its 33 games, or 60.6%, when favored by at least -115 on the moneyline.
  • Sportsbooks have implied with the moneyline set for this matchup that the Padres have a 53.5% chance to win.
  • The Giants have been chosen as underdogs in 24 games this year and have walked away with the win 12 times (50%) in those games.
  • This year, San Francisco has won nine of 18 games when listed as at least -104 or worse on the moneyline.
  • The Giants have an implied victory probability of 51% according to the moneyline set for this matchup.

Padres Player Insights

  • Fernando Tatis Jr. leads the Padres with 13 home runs on the year. He's also hitting .273 with 28 RBI.
  • Of all hitters in the majors, Tatis ranks 16th in home runs and 80th in RBI.
  • Tatis carries a three-game hitting streak into this matchup. In his last five games he is hitting .316 with a double and three walks.
  • Manny Machado is hitting .314 to pace his team.
  • Machado is 92nd in homers and 74th in RBI in the bigs.
  • Machado heads into this game looking for his third game in a row with a hit. During his last five outings he is batting .316 with a home run, two walks and four RBIs.
  • Luis Arraez is hitting .281 with 12 doubles, three triples, three home runs and 11 walks.
  • Sheets' 38 runs batted in lead his team.

Giants Player Insights

  • Jung Hoo Lee has 16 doubles, two triples, six home runs and 15 walks while hitting .274.
  • In all of MLB, Lee is 116th in homers and 54th in RBI.
  • Heliot Ramos has showcased his ability as a power hitter this season, as he paces his team with 11 home runs with a club-high .292 batting average.
  • Among all major league hitters, Ramos ranks 33rd in home runs and 45th in RBI.
  • Wilmer Flores has collected a team-high 47 runs batted in.
  • Matt Chapman leads the Giants with 11 home runs.
